Common Causes of Foundation Problems in Southampton

Foundation issues have a few possible causes. Here are the top ones for Southampton residents:

  • Aging plumbing: The average Southampton home construction year is 1976. If you live in an older home, it's likely to have cast-iron plumbing. When the pipes start eroding, leaking water could reach your foundation and even pool beneath it.
  • Soil composition: Soil with large sand or clay concentrations is highly expansive. In the heavy rainfall Southampton gets, the soil absorbs moisture like a sponge, then releases it in dry seasons. The constant expansion and contraction puts pressure on nearby foundations, even if the foundations stay dry.
  • Improper modifications: Roofing or landscaping work that wasn't performed to standard could result in your foundation settling.
  • Topsoil Frost: When temperatures plunge, topsoil abruptly ices over and lower layers can't expand, pushing upper layers to heave and permanently damage infrastructure.
  • Tree Roots: Tree roots can enter a home's foundation through cracks, and may create stress that results in your foundation breaking, pipes leaking, and overall structural weakening.

How to Choose the Best Foundation Repair Company

Your home's foundation is vital to its stability, so it's important to work with a reliable foundation repair provider. Assess each provider using the following criteria:

Licensing and Experience

New York's state government doesn't issue contracting licenses, but cities often choose to require them of foundation companies and other builders. For example, New York City requires foundation and excavating contractors to obtain a "Safety Registration Number" with a concrete work endorsement. They also need to register as a general contractor or home improvement contractor. To further understand your contractor's experience, we recommend asking questions about how its team will draft plans and pull permits, what local codes apply to your project, and how the company inspects foundations.

One of the most effective ways to evaluate a company's reputation is to explore its website. Look for the company's history and the qualifications its team holds. Many leading companies provide educational content for potential customers.

Customer Reviews

When you're researching a company's credibility, go to its Better Business Bureau (BBB) profile. There, you can find its rating and a list of customer reviews, both positive experiences and complaints. Negative feedback doesn't mean a contractor is unreliable. BBB reviews show how the company handled complaints. It's a good sign if the company has resolved issues appropriately and proactively. You should avoid a company with numerous negative reviews, no credentials, and no communication regarding issues.

Foundation Repair Cost in Southampton

Foundation repair costs can differ significantly based on the degree of the problems and what must be done to fix them. For minor foundation fracturing and settling problems, you may pay as little as $1,800. However, if there is significant destruction, the normal cost will be around $2,900. More involved jobs involving tunneling, helical piers, or major concrete leveling could run you $6,900. This table shows the average foundation repair costs for common issues.

Common Foundation Repair ServicesAverage Cost
Crack Repair$343
Leak Repair$2,742
Stabilization$4,740
Underpinning$1,314
Waterproofing$3,027

Frequently Asked Questions About Foundation Repair in Southampton

What will I pay to repair my foundation in Southampton?

You could pay about $2,900 on materials and labor for your foundation project. Ultimately, your expenses will depend on your specific needs and the extent of the issues.

When do I need to waterproof my foundation?

Some signs your home needs foundation waterproofing include plumbing leaks, uneven floors, discoloration or odors, flooding, mold or mildew growth, and hairline cracks.

Note that there are two kinds of waterproofing. Interior waterproofing involves installing drains and sump pumps or using sealants around a cellar. Outdoor waterproofing is typically less expensive. It involves installing exterior drains and creating physical barriers between your foundation and yard.

Will my homeowners insurance cover foundation repair?

Sometimes. Whether you'll have coverage depends on the types of policies you have and why the foundation damage happened. Earthquake or flood insurance will typically cover foundation damage caused by those specific disasters. A standard homeowners policy can cover damage from other disasters, but will not cover normal wear and tear. We recommend consulting your insurance agent about your coverage and the process of filing a claim.

What preventive measures can I take to avoid foundation issues?

You can take several preventive measures to avoid foundation issues:
  • Ensure your home's gutters and downspouts are properly installed and direct water away from your foundation to avoid water accumulation.
  • Irrigate the soil around your foundation evenly, especially during dry spells, to prevent shrinking and expansion.
  • If possible, grade the soil around your home to slope away from your foundation, promoting water drainage and reducing the risk of foundation issues.
  • Inspect your foundation for signs of damage, and address any issues immediately.
